WebApr 2, 2024 · Beijing embroidery, or jingxiu, is the general term that refers to the style of embroidery products made in the Beijing region, having distinctive regional features. The style of Beijing embroidery traces its beginnings to the palace, for which it also earned the name “palace embroidery.”. WebThere are four main styles of embroidery in China: Su, Xiang, Yue and Shu styles. The history of Su embroidery, which is one of the most famous embroidery styles in China, has spanned more than ... WebEach region of China had their own distinctive style of embroidery. The oldest known style originates from the Sichuan province. This style is painstakingly precise, characterized by even stitches and subtle colors. The Guangdong province favored more geometric patterns and primary colors.
